Discounts

Available to Community and Maker memberships. Discounts address financial barriers by lowering the base price for those who need it.

  • Priority Groups (- 50%): Artists of Colour, Deaf Artists, and Artists with Disabilities, Francophone Artists, Indigenous Artists, 2SLGBTQIA+ Artists

  • Distance (- 40%): Living 100km outside of Toronto.

  • Students (- 80%): Full-time enrolment in an educational institution. (Only for Maker Members)

  • Seniors (- 40%): Individuals 65 years or older.

  • Sliding Scale: For folks who find the price of membership a financial barrier. A custom price can be selected ranging from full price to 50% off.

 
* Members who identify with more than one group can select the category with the greatest discount.

Program Administration Fees

Current Maker Members do not pay any administrative fees.

Non-members now have access to apply for Craft Ontario Programs. For a $10 administrative fee, makers who are not yet members are welcome to apply. If the work is juried into a program, the individual must then join by purchasing a membership.

Who We Are

Formerly the Ontario Crafts Council, Craft Ontario is a not-for-profit service organization that works to have craft recognized as a valuable part of life. We promote and celebrate professional craft through providing member opportunities, and advocate for craft practice by educating and empowering diverse audiences.
